Leadership Review Briefing — Warranty Overrun

Heads of department: the Mirella cooktop line's warranty costs are tracking 30% over budget, mostly ignition-module failures. Jonas is negotiating a recovery with the supplier, Hexvale Components, and we should know more next week. Keep this off the wider distribution for now — here's the piece that stays in this room:

board note of kageg-bahof: The renewal with Holwynax Holdings closes at $2 million a year, 5 percent below the last contract. Project Ulaath slips by two quarters because of the supplier delay.

Finance Review Summary — Training Budget, Next Fiscal Year

Prepared for the heads of department. The proposed training allocation rises eight percent, driven mainly by the Larkspur certification program and expanded onboarding at the Dunmere site. Travel-linked training is trimmed in favor of facilitated remote cohorts. Department caps remain unchanged pending the December review. Please weigh your requests against the strategic direction noted confidentially below.

confidential, tagep-yahag: Headcount on the Oliael team goes from 5 to 100 by the end of July. Gross margin on Oliael came in at 20 percent against a plan of 15 percent.

## Runbook: PeriodWeaver solver stuck

If the timetable solver for Brackenhollow Academy hangs past 10 minutes, it's almost always a stale lock in the constraints cache. Restart the worker pod first — seriously, that fixes 80% of pages. If schedules come back empty, check that the term calendar synced overnight. Before the worker will accept jobs again, its env file needs the solver auth secret on the next line. Add it right here:

sealed setting: ARCHIVE_KEY3=8d0

Action item (P2): The Snapfold thumbnail queue stalled when oversized PNGs hit the resize worker and retries piled up unbounded. Add a max-retry cap of 3, dead-letter anything larger than 40MB, and emit a queue-depth metric per shard. Owner: Derran. Due end of sprint. Reviewers should check the backoff math carefully. The full dead-letter runbook lives on the internal wiki page below.

dashboard of bafof-hafog = https://confluence.lumiclabs.internal/display/browse/display/6a09a20a